社区专家-Monster-XH 2022-01-06 14:57 采纳率: 100%
浏览 89
已结题

有点问题,关键是我做不出来

编写一个冒泡排序法的函数,在主函数中进行调用,使该函数能实现对一个具有8个元素的数组进行排序,在主函数中将排序结果进行输出。

  • 写回答

1条回答 默认 最新

  • CSDN专家-sinJack 2022-01-06 15:09
    关注
    #include<stdio.h>
    void bubble(int*a,int n)
    {int i,j,t;
    for(i=0;i<n-1;i++)
    for(j=0;j<n-1-i;j++)
    if(a[j]>a[j+1])
    {t=a[j];a[j]=a[j+1];a[j+1]=t;}
    }
    int main()
    {int i,a[8];
    for(i=0;i<8;i++)
    scanf("%d",&a[i]);
    bubble(a,8);
    for(i=0;i<8;i++)
    printf("%d ",a[i]);
    printf("\n");
    return 0;
    }
    
    
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论
    1人已打赏

报告相同问题?

问题事件

  • 已结题 (查看结题原因) 1月6日
  • 已采纳回答 1月6日
  • 创建了问题 1月6日

悬赏问题

  • ¥15 爬取豆瓣电影相关处理
  • ¥15 手机淘宝抓清除消息接口
  • ¥15 C#无selenium
  • ¥15 LD衰减计算的结果过大
  • ¥15 用机器学习方法帮助保险公司预测哪些是欺诈行为
  • ¥15 计算300m以内的LD衰减
  • ¥15 数据爬取,python
  • ¥15 怎么看 cst中一个面的功率分布图,请说明详细步骤。类似下图
  • ¥15 为什么我的pycharm无法用pyqt6的QtWebEngine
  • ¥15 FOR循环语句显示查询超过300S错误怎么办